How this custom passed from Ireland to Canada and also parts of the U.S is an interesting procession in itself because it was said to originate from the influx of Irish people into the U.S after the great famine of the 1840s landing and settling in places like Gross Isle in Quebec places not unconnected to bereavement because many people came across the Atlantic in dreadful conditions the boats were known as coffin ships because many people died en route to the new world. When someone died without being able to confess their sins, a Sin Eater would be called upon and given bread and ale that was either passed over the body, or eaten in front of the corpse.
